Job Description
Duties:
* Assess and determine supportive services to meet each client's unique needs
* Coordinate necessary services based on needs assessment such as assistance with housing, funding for treatment, health insurance, employment
* Assist clients in implementing a daily routine through all stages of recovery
* Provide education, screening, and referral for communicable diseases
* Act as a liaison between client and other providers assisting in client care
* Accurately document interactions and sessions with clients
